The advertising turnover in Denmark stood at 2.14 Billion Euros in 2023. Over the past decade, the market presented fluctuating growth, with notable increases in 2015 (2.97%) and 2019 (4.5%), but significant declines in 2016 (-2.1%) and 2020 (-8.2%). More recent years saw a continued contraction with a year-on-year decrease of 1.32% in both 2022 and 2023. The last five-year CAGR is -1.52%, reflecting a shrinking advertising market in Denmark.
Looking ahead, the forecasted data suggests a continuation of this downward trend, with the advertising turnover expected to decline to 2.01 Billion Euros by 2028, representing a forecasted five-year CAGR of -1.06% and a forecast five-year growth rate of -5.17%.
